Transaction edf81daa8fea144812091c8f1b4a335783a34e74ff7c08f925783c08afd22a6a
1 Input
1 Output
-
edf81daa8fea144812091c8f1b4a335783a34e74ff7c08f925783c08afd22a6a:0
- value
- 671606
- script pubkey
- OP_0 OP_PUSHBYTES_20 0be2d17b3782bd16ecf1b92e28e73468ae4b1429
- address
- bc1qp03dz7ehs273dm83hyhz3ee5dzhyk9pfjwl6ls